摘要
Purpose-This study aims to holistically present a systematic literature review (SLR) triangulated with bibliometric analysis on environmental, social and governance (ESG) research to synthesize and comprehensively review its evolving journey and emerging research streams. Design/methodology/approach-Using R-studio software, this study carried out a retrospective quantitative bibliometric analysis through performance analysis, science mapping and network analysis, covering 261 documents published on ESG research between 2007 and 2022 in Scopus and Web of Science databases. Findings- Performance analysis depicts the trends in publications, impactful journals and influential publications, authors and countries, while science mapping incorporates co-words and thematic analysis. Likewise, co-occurrence analysis provided four different clusters, representing ESG research linkage to other management fields along with key insights from co-citation network analysis. Additionally, the theory-context-characteristics-methods (TCCM) framework has provided valuable results in terms of widely and emerging used theories, contexts, characteristics and methodologies in ESG research. Research limitations/implications-The findings of this study's comprehensive bibliometric analysis combined with SLR uncovered a robust roadmap for further investigation in ESG research by identifying the inherent structure and evolution of research themes. This review has not only identified the prevalent gaps in determining priorities for future research but also provides insights which not previously been captured and evaluated on this topic. Originality/value-To the best of the author's knowledge, no study presents the TCCM framework in the context of bibliometric analysis of ESG research. Besides, a conceptual framework is developed that illustrates antecedents, mediators, moderators and outcomes of research on ESG practices and provides the concluded key takeaways and recommendations for potential authors intending to publish their research papers on ESG practices.
